Shake-Up in Major Cryptocurrencies: Bitcoin, Ethereum, XRP, and Shiba Inu Face Critical Testing

In the dynamic world of cryptocurrencies, Bitcoin, Ethereum, XRP, and Shiba Inu are currently navigating through pivotal support levels. Bitcoin recently retreated to approximately $77,300 after failing to breach the $80,000 to $81,000 range. Ethereum, maintaining a sideways trend, is at $2,441. Meanwhile, XRP is attempting to stabilize between $1.33 and $1.36. Shiba Inu has slipped below its rising trend line, suggesting increased vulnerability.

Contents
What Is Influencing Bitcoin and Ethereum?Support Challenges for XRP and Shiba Inu?

What Is Influencing Bitcoin and Ethereum?

Bitcoin, the largest cryptocurrency by market cap, is displaying sensitivity to shifts in global risk appetite. Climbing above $81,000 recently, it now faces downward correction pressures as U.S. inflation data and upcoming Federal Reserve decisions loom. Rising bond yields and oil prices have contributed to a cautious sentiment in the market. An analysis indicates Bitcoin is sitting within the $76,000 to $77,000 range, considered a crucial short-term support zone.

Bitcoin’s primary short-term support lies between $76,000 and $77,000.

Limited to a technical correction, Bitcoin’s first dynamic support is at $75,967, with major averages at around $72,863, $70,675, and $70,417, showing that the August breakout momentum remains intact. However, a declining relative strength index (RSI) at 55.5 signals weakened upward momentum. Failure to hold the $76,000 to $77,000 band may push Bitcoin towards $72,800 to $73,000, while reclaiming $79,000 could revisit the $80,000 to $82,000 zone.

Ethereum is also experiencing compression. Having climbed from $1,900 to over $2,500 in August, it currently hovers at $2,441. Immediate dynamic support stands at $2,362, with longer-term averages at $2,190, $2,148, and $2,115, suggesting that maintaining the $2,360 to $2,400 range ensures the August breakout structure remains valid.

A close below $2,350 could severely damage Ethereum’s current structure.

Support Challenges for XRP and Shiba Inu?

XRP, linked to the Ripple ecosystem, is in a delicate position at $1.36, losing much of its August gains. Short and long-term averages converge around $1.337 and $1.355, respectively, making the $1.33 to $1.36 range critical. XRP’s previous bullish trend from $1.00 to $1.70 was not sustained above $1.50, with lower peaks forming at $1.45, $1.43, and $1.41. If it closes below $1.33, a drop to $1.24 becomes a risk, while a recovery may target $1.40 to $1.42.

Shiba Inu’s outlook appears bleaker, dipping to approximately $0.00000509, a decline of around 3.2%. The breakdown of its rising trend line suggests structural weakening, with the proximity of moving averages at $0.00000517, $0.00000504, and $0.00000494 highlighting $0.0000049 to $0.0000050 as a near-term support zone.

Shiba Inu’s RSI has fallen to 48.2, slipping below both the signal average and the neutral 50 threshold, indicating a lack of buyer confidence in the short term. If $0.0000049 is breached, attention may shift to $0.0000046 and potentially the August low at $0.0000044. Conversely, reclaiming $0.0000053 might improve its short-term outlook.

  • Bitcoin faces a key support zone between $76,000 and $77,000; failure below this may test $72,800 to $73,000.
  • Ethereum needs to sustain the $2,360 to $2,400 range to maintain its August breakout structure.
  • XRP’s critical range is $1.33 to $1.36; a breach below could risk deeper corrections.
  • Shiba Inu could see further declines if support at $0.0000049 fails, with previous lows at risk.

Moving forward, market participants will likely focus on macroeconomic indicators and policy announcements, which could significantly impact these cryptocurrencies’ trajectories. As these digital assets hover around their support zones, their future movements will be critical for investors to watch closely.
